Formal Ways to Say “Princess” in Persian

1. شاهدخت (Shahdokht)

Shahdokht is the most common way to say “princess” in Persian. It is a formal and widely used term. This word can be broken down into two parts: شاه (shah), meaning “king” or “emperor,” and دخت (dokht), meaning “daughter.” Therefore, the literal translation of شاهدخت is “king’s daughter” or “daughter of the emperor.”

2. پرنسس (Prinçes)

پرنسس is the Persian transliteration of the English word “princess.” While it is commonly used in written Persian, it is not as prevalent in spoken language. This term is often used in formal contexts, especially when referring to foreign princesses or royal titles.
